The project isn't broken, I just discovered what happens, LMMS can't load or save scale settings, everything is loaded as logarithmic even if you saved the values using a linear scale (I guess logarithmic is the standard, I do not know which is which).
Edit: I̶ ̶t̶h̶i̶n̶k̶ ̶t̶h̶e̶ ̶o̶n̶l̶y̶ ̶f̶i̶x̶ ̶i̶s̶ ̶t̶o̶ ̶s̶w̶i̶t̶c̶h̶ ̶t̶h̶e̶ ̶s̶c̶a̶l̶e̶ ̶o̶f̶ ̶t̶h̶e̶ ̶d̶e̶s̶i̶r̶e̶d̶ ̶k̶n̶o̶b̶ ̶e̶v̶e̶r̶y̶t̶i̶m̶e̶ ̶y̶o̶u̶ ̶l̶o̶a̶d̶ ̶a̶ ̶p̶r̶o̶j̶e̶c̶t̶.
T̶h̶a̶t̶ ̶w̶o̶r̶k̶e̶d̶ ̶f̶o̶r̶ ̶m̶e̶.
No, sorry, that doesn't work. When you switch the scale and export the song, it switch back...
